Output 20298cdc00dddd3eb1aabcd374d5e54afc5bd80aa839eee97695485f8f28c229:11

value
445346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 385291b0c7b9fc74aa058d06330a1975e0f4bce1 OP_EQUAL
address
36ppgHfcv1Li5FyyyUHosdDzLctbVQLcm5
transaction
20298cdc00dddd3eb1aabcd374d5e54afc5bd80aa839eee97695485f8f28c229
confirmations
151132
spent
true